get:
Show a patch.

patch:
Update a patch.

put:
Update a patch.

GET /api/patches/75181/?format=api
HTTP 200 OK
Allow: GET, PUT, PATCH, HEAD, OPTIONS
Content-Type: application/json
Vary: Accept

{
    "id": 75181,
    "url": "http://patches.dpdk.org/api/patches/75181/?format=api",
    "web_url": "http://patches.dpdk.org/project/web/patch/20200804095846.8964-1-david.marchand@redhat.com/",
    "project": {
        "id": 4,
        "url": "http://patches.dpdk.org/api/projects/4/?format=api",
        "name": "WEB",
        "link_name": "web",
        "list_id": "web.dpdk.org",
        "list_email": "web@dpdk.org",
        "web_url": "",
        "scm_url": "git://dpdk.org/tools/dpdk-web",
        "webscm_url": "http://git.dpdk.org/tools/dpdk-web/",
        "list_archive_url": "https://inbox.dpdk.org/web",
        "list_archive_url_format": "https://inbox.dpdk.org/web/{}",
        "commit_url_format": ""
    },
    "msgid": "<20200804095846.8964-1-david.marchand@redhat.com>",
    "list_archive_url": "https://inbox.dpdk.org/web/20200804095846.8964-1-david.marchand@redhat.com",
    "date": "2020-08-04T09:58:46",
    "name": "[RFC] prepare 20.11 roadmap",
    "commit_ref": null,
    "pull_url": null,
    "state": "superseded",
    "archived": false,
    "hash": "47593552b2e27e25be5f749eb29cd70464345a97",
    "submitter": {
        "id": 1173,
        "url": "http://patches.dpdk.org/api/people/1173/?format=api",
        "name": "David Marchand",
        "email": "david.marchand@redhat.com"
    },
    "delegate": null,
    "mbox": "http://patches.dpdk.org/project/web/patch/20200804095846.8964-1-david.marchand@redhat.com/mbox/",
    "series": [
        {
            "id": 11489,
            "url": "http://patches.dpdk.org/api/series/11489/?format=api",
            "web_url": "http://patches.dpdk.org/project/web/list/?series=11489",
            "date": "2020-08-04T09:58:46",
            "name": "[RFC] prepare 20.11 roadmap",
            "version": 1,
            "mbox": "http://patches.dpdk.org/series/11489/mbox/"
        }
    ],
    "comments": "http://patches.dpdk.org/api/patches/75181/comments/",
    "check": "pending",
    "checks": "http://patches.dpdk.org/api/patches/75181/checks/",
    "tags": {},
    "related": [],
    "headers": {
        "Return-Path": "<web-bounces@dpdk.org>",
        "X-Original-To": "patchwork@inbox.dpdk.org",
        "Delivered-To": "patchwork@inbox.dpdk.org",
        "Received": [
            "from dpdk.org (dpdk.org [92.243.14.124])\n\tby inbox.dpdk.org (Postfix) with ESMTP id CD0C8A053A;\n\tTue,  4 Aug 2020 11:59:07 +0200 (CEST)",
            "from [92.243.14.124] (localhost [127.0.0.1])\n\tby dpdk.org (Postfix) with ESMTP id 846CC1C00D;\n\tTue,  4 Aug 2020 11:59:07 +0200 (CEST)",
            "from us-smtp-delivery-124.mimecast.com\n (us-smtp-delivery-124.mimecast.com [216.205.24.124])\n by dpdk.org (Postfix) with ESMTP id EF40529D2\n for <web@dpdk.org>; Tue,  4 Aug 2020 11:59:05 +0200 (CEST)",
            "from mimecast-mx01.redhat.com (mimecast-mx01.redhat.com\n [209.132.183.4]) (Using TLS) by relay.mimecast.com with ESMTP id\n us-mta-271-JwFn0vSQPfyYGO5xJsnmlA-1; Tue, 04 Aug 2020 05:59:01 -0400",
            "from smtp.corp.redhat.com (int-mx08.intmail.prod.int.phx2.redhat.com\n [10.5.11.23])\n (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its))\n (No client certificate requested)\n by mimecast-mx01.redhat.com (Postfix) with ESMTPS id D6BA6100AA29;\n Tue,  4 Aug 2020 09:58:59 +0000 (UTC)",
            "from dmarchan.remote.csb (unknown [10.40.193.204])\n by smtp.corp.redhat.com (Postfix) with ESMTP id 09B49282E1;\n Tue,  4 Aug 2020 09:58:53 +0000 (UTC)"
        ],
        "DKIM-Signature": "v=1; a=rsa-sha256; c=relaxed/relaxed; d=redhat.com;\n s=mimecast20190719; t=1596535145;\n h=from:from:reply-to:subject:subject:date:date:message-id:message-id:\n to:to:cc:mime-version:mime-version:content-type:content-type:\n content-transfer-encoding:content-transfer-encoding;\n bh=IBCbz7N04HVUgKJBcAaTwF6HaLvn5gT01ZIloYQaAMA=;\n b=g2PrKdNOW9/rNIK+0RLAbIkpq0ttaASxCQqVmJQ3c6GvA3czHJy9+MGzcfjcsHbGEnZ3b2\n jzyEr7cudM6RhqxDRhxp4f2mdXySe4CPMOz/pwTIN8G24gM7IeRVoJDUrH8ukUiN5wVpdT\n xrHwvFuEFdtGdImXvFs4Igg6Ut5rO7A=",
        "X-MC-Unique": "JwFn0vSQPfyYGO5xJsnmlA-1",
        "From": "David Marchand <david.marchand@redhat.com>",
        "To": "web@dpdk.org, thomas@monjalon.net, ferruh.yigit@intel.com,\n ajit.khaparde@broadcom.com, qi.z.zhang@intel.com, jerinj@marvell.com,\n rasland@mellanox.com, maxime.coquelin@redhat.com, akhil.goyal@nxp.com",
        "Date": "Tue,  4 Aug 2020 11:58:46 +0200",
        "Message-Id": "<20200804095846.8964-1-david.marchand@redhat.com>",
        "MIME-Version": "1.0",
        "X-Scanned-By": "MIMEDefang 2.84 on 10.5.11.23",
        "X-Mimecast-Spam-Score": "0",
        "X-Mimecast-Originator": "redhat.com",
        "Content-Type": "text/plain; charset=US-ASCII",
        "Content-Transfer-Encoding": "8bit",
        "Subject": "[dpdk-web] [RFC PATCH] prepare 20.11 roadmap",
        "X-BeenThere": "web@dpdk.org",
        "X-Mailman-Version": "2.1.15",
        "Precedence": "list",
        "List-Id": "DPDK website maintenance <web.dpdk.org>",
        "List-Unsubscribe": "<https://mails.dpdk.org/options/web>,\n <mailto:web-request@dpdk.org?subject=unsubscribe>",
        "List-Archive": "<http://mails.dpdk.org/archives/web/>",
        "List-Post": "<mailto:web@dpdk.org>",
        "List-Help": "<mailto:web-request@dpdk.org?subject=help>",
        "List-Subscribe": "<https://mails.dpdk.org/listinfo/web>,\n <mailto:web-request@dpdk.org?subject=subscribe>",
        "Errors-To": "web-bounces@dpdk.org",
        "Sender": "\"web\" <web-bounces@dpdk.org>"
    },
    "content": "Signed-off-by: David Marchand <david.marchand@redhat.com>\n---\nHello tree maintainers,\n\nI prepared this roadmap update based on the 20.08 release notes and my\nunderstanding of the changes that happened in the drivers.\nI moved to 20.11 the features still in progress or for which I did not\nfind changes.\nPlease chime in if you think there are still things to do wrt the\npreviously announced features.\n\nThanks!\n\n---\n content/roadmap/_index.md | 41 ++-------------------------------------\n 1 file changed, 2 insertions(+), 39 deletions(-)",
    "diff": "diff --git a/content/roadmap/_index.md b/content/roadmap/_index.md\nindex a284668..548b6e1 100644\n--- a/content/roadmap/_index.md\n+++ b/content/roadmap/_index.md\n@@ -9,69 +9,32 @@ This is not a commitment but plan of work.\n This list is obviously neither complete nor guaranteed.\n {{% /notice %}}\n \n-### Version 20.08 (2020 August) {#2008}\n+### Version 20.11 (2020 November) {#2011}\n \n <!-- General -->\n-- external thread registration API\n-- log registration constructor\n-- removal of non-kernel based PCI probing\n-- bit operations API for drivers\n - x86 direct-store (write-combined) memory write (movdiri)\n-- Arm CPU frequency calculation using generic counter\n-- Armv8-a IO barriers changed to use DMB instruction\n - Arm CRC32 in generic API\n-- C11 atomic semantics in mbuf, eventdev, EAL interrupts\n <!-- Networking -->\n-- integrate RCU library with LPM library\n - FIB vector lookup\n - Tx QoS marking API\n - flow action object API\n - flow sampling and mirroring API\n <!-- Network drivers -->\n-- bnxt VF representor and multi-device\n-- bnxt optimization for Arm, burst mode info and flow counters\n-- bnxt VLAN pop/push, VXLAN encap/decap, L2/L3/L4 rewrite and TTL decrement\n-- i40e switch filter programming for DNS\n-- i40e flow director rule insertion rate optimization\n-- ice DCF, GTP-U, IPv6 RSS, and PPPoE enhancement\n-- ice flow based RSS improvement and add more protocols\n-- ice ethertype filtering on flow director\n-- ixgbe/i40e legacy filter API replacement\n-- igb/ixgbe/i40e/ice base code update\n-- performance optimizations in mlx drivers for Arm platforms\n - mlx5 memory management options, and queue stop/start\n-- mlx5 eCPRI matching and Tx scheduling for 5G\n-- mlx5 vDPA device counters\n-- octeontx2 parameters for Rx/Tx context locking\n - octeontx2 packet mirroring\n+- octeontx2 rte_tm enhancement\n - qede SR-IOV PF\n <!-- Virtualisation -->\n-- vhost async API\n-- vhost DMA operations with CBDMA ioat driver\n-- vhost REPLY_ACK advertised unconditionally\n-- vhost SET_STATUS\n - virtio-user GET/SET_PROTOCOL_FEATURES, REPLY_ACK, SET_STATUS\n <!-- Network apps -->\n - IF proxy\n-- testpmd swap forwarding for L2/L3/L4\n-- l2fwd forwarding between asymmetric ports\n - performance test for IP reassembly\n-- performance test application for flow rules\n <!-- Crypto -->\n-- crypto-CRC chained operation\n-- octeontx2 crypto protocol lookaside and ChaCha-Poly\n-- qat multi-process support and Chacha-Poly\n-- ipsec-secgw flow distribution and stats per-core\n <!-- Others -->\n-- regexdev\n - regex driver based on libpcre\n - Dynamic Load Balancer event driver\n - UBSan in build\n \n-### Version 20.11 (2020 November) {#2011}\n-\n-- rte_tm enhancement for OCTEON TX2\n-\n ### Nice to have - Future {#future}\n ----\n - integrate RCU deferred resource reclamation API with hash library\n",
    "prefixes": [
        "RFC"
    ]
}